I ahve been tracking my calories for a while. The other day i noticed that hwne my calories in stay the same but my calories out increases (due to exercise) my calories in my budget decreases. If I am exercising and increasing how many calories I have going out shouldn't my budgeted calories increase?
I have not changed my settings, I am just not sure what is going on with the in vs. out. I have looked at other subjects on this in the forum but can't seem to find an answer to this.

In regards of your Calories "In vs Out", every time that you workout and your calories burned increases, the tile "Left to eat" will increase; letting you know that you're able to eat more, since your burning more calories.
